Piperidines
Piperidine is an azacycloalkane that is cyclohexane in which one of the carbons is replaced by a nitrogen. Although piperidine is a common organic compound, it is an immensely important class of compounds medicinally: the piperidine ring is the most common heterocyclic subunit among FDA approved drugs.

Cyclohexanes
Cyclohexane is an organic compound with a chemical formula C6H12. It is a colorless liquid with a pungent odor, insoluble in water, and soluble in most organic solvents such as ethanol, ether, benzene, and acetone. Cyclohexyl fragments are a common structure in both natural and synthetic drugs. It can be used as both core structure and part of achiral side chain.
Oxazolines
Oxazolines are five-membered heterocyclic compounds with one double bond. The double bond may be in one of three positions, so there may be three different oxazoline rings. The 2-oxazoline structure is the most common, and 3-oxazoline and 4-oxazoline exist mainly as laboratory research compounds. Oxazolines exist between oxazole and oxazolidine in terms of saturation.
